1. For shipping purposes, the chute deflector on
your mower is held in an upright position by a
retainer. Removethe retainer as follows:
a. Push chute deflector up towards engine.
Holding deflector in this position, remove
the retainer and discard. See Figure 3-1.
b. Lower the chute deflector carefully keeping
your fingers out of the way.
2. Perform the following sequence for handle
setup:
a. Lift the upper handle up from folded
position A and pull it to extended position
B following the arrow in Figure 3-2. The
handle should click into this position.
b. Make sure the carriage bolt is seated
properly in the handle. Tighten wing nuts
securing upper handleto the lower handle.
3. If satisfied with height of handle, tighten wing
nuts at the ends of the lower handle shown in
Figure 3-3. For convenience of operating,you
may adjust the handle height as follows:
a. Remove the wing nuts shown in Figure 3-3
and remove the lower handle.
,
b. Positioneach handle bracket stud into the
top hole in the lower handle.
c. Tighten the wing nuts.
